Hulk Hogan’s nephew suffers knockout loss in viral fight
David Bollea, known as 'King' David Hogan and the nephew of wrestling legend Hulk Hogan, faced a tough defeat in his most recent MMA bout at Fury Challenger Series 5. The 42-year-old fighter entered the cage with a record of ten fights, but ended up being knocked out by Paul Garza, who has a record of four wins and three losses. The bout was short-lived, concluding in just one round when Garza delivered a left hook that sent Bollea crashing face-first to the mat. The footage of the knockout quickly circulated online, showcasing the harsh realities of combat sports. Following the fight, Bollea expressed gratitude for martial arts despite the setback, stating that it enriches his life and allows him to experience the world.
